Abstract

The review analyzes the published data on scientific, applied, and marketing studies on the development of modern synthetic bases of motor oils as marketable products. The conventional world-accepted classifications and performance characteristics of base oils are considered. The main trends in scientific research on the development of effective synthetic bases of motor oils and prospects for their further development are presented. The assessment of the state of the global and Russian motor oil markets according to major market indicators is given; the market development forecast for the coming years is presented.
